首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>选择列表更新目标primefaces 5

选择列表更新目标primefaces 5
EN

Stack Overflow用户
提问于 2014-05-15 03:13:27
回答 1查看 343关注 0票数 0

我正在使用primefaces的picklist,我有以下问题,当我创建一个对象时,它可以工作,但当我尝试更新这个对象时,目标列表变成空的。

代码语言:javascript
运行
复制
<div class="row">
        <div class="large-4 columns">
            <p:outputLabel id="lblDescricao" value="Descrição"/>
            <p:inputText id="txtDescricao" value="#{cadastroProdutoController.produto.descricao}" 
                         required="true" requiredMessage="Campo obrigatório" maxlength="30"/>
            <p:message id="msgDescricao" for="txtDescricao"/>
        </div>

        <div class="large-4 columns end">
            <p:pickList id="listTipoProduto" value="#{cadastroProdutoController.tipoProdutos}" var="tipoProduto"
                        itemLabel="#{tipoProduto.descricao}" itemValue="#{tipoProduto}">
                <f:facet name="sourceCaption">Não Associados</f:facet>
                <f:facet name="targetCaption">Associados</f:facet>

                <o:converter converterId="omnifaces.ListConverter" list="#{cadastroProdutoController.listaTodosTipoProdutoInner}" />
            </p:pickList>
        </div>
    </div>

    <div class="row">
        <div class="large-6 large-centered columns alinhamento_centro">
            <p:commandButton id="btnSalvar" value="SALVAR" validateClient="true" action="#{cadastroProdutoController.salvar}" update="@form"/>
            <p:spacer width="20px"/>
            <p:commandButton id="btnVoltar" value="VOLTAR" action="/paginas/cadastro/produtoPesquisa.xhtml?faces-redirect=true" immediate="true" ajax="false"/>
        </div>
    </div>
EN

回答 1

Stack Overflow用户

发布于 2014-05-15 19:38:06

我认为您的转换器或控制器有问题。有没有可用的代码来帮助你?

还有我的两个2cents:如果你想有更多的人帮助你,不要用你的外语命名你的对象/id。它很难读懂。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/23663208

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档